A few weeks ago, I got to spend some time at the Portland Art Museum. It wasn’t something I planned but found myself having time to explore…I was so surprised to find out they had one of Monet’s water lily paintings. He has always been my favorite painter and but to finally see his work in person, evoked something that’s never happened to me before and I instantly broke down.

You see, when I painted my table it took forever because I obsessed over the details. You can look at and read all the books in the world but it wasn’t until I saw his brush strokes in person that it clicked for me.

I was so lucky to have that gallery to myself for 20 minutes and allow myself take in his work and digest what it meant to me. (Also so no one saw me cry in public - thank god)

It will forever be considered one of the most special moments I’ll ever experience and I sincerely hope everyone gets a moment like this for whatever inspires them most.
